using OpenCvSharp;
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
namespace _05_sobel边缘检测
{
internal class Program
{
static void Main(string[] args)
{
Mat gard_x= new Mat();
Mat abs_gard_x = new Mat();
Mat gard_y = new Mat();
Mat abs_gard_y = new Mat();
Mat dst = new Mat();
Mat src= Cv2.ImRead(@"F:\AI视觉23班\06_OpenCV\images\airline-stewardess-bikini.jpg");
Cv2.ImShow("原图", src);
//参数1:输入图像
//参数2:输出图像
//参数3:输出的图像的类型
//参数4,参数5: 1,0 表示求dx=1 dy=0的方向的一阶导数
//求 x方向的梯度
Cv2.Sobel(src, gard_x,MatType.CV_16S,1,0);
//用于对图片进行高亮处理
Cv2.ConvertScaleAbs(gard_x, abs_gard_x);
Cv2.ImShow(